Welcome to episode 018 of the Tragically Beautiful podcast.  In this episode, you will find so much wisdom, encouragement and hope to empower you to take back control of creating your best, most beautiful life.  Join me as I have this amazing conversation with abuse survivor, wife, mama, business owner and author, Cielo Bradshaw.

Key takeaways:

  • Look at your wounds as allies, not as enemies

  • Although it’s very difficult to think this way, look for the ways in which you may have contributed to your situation so that you don’t repeat the pattern in the future

  • Self-love is giving yourself the space and understanding that people’s behavior who mistreated you or hurt you has nothing to do with your identity

  • When you heal your wounds it is connected to taking your power back and living the life that was made for you
